Why Rent a Car in Sudbury?

Sudbury, Ontario, is a vibrant city surrounded by stunning natural landscapes. While public transport is available, renting a car gives you the freedom to explore at your own pace.

Explore Scenic Routes: Sudbury is near numerous lakes, forests, and parks. A rental car lets you easily access these natural attractions, like Killarney Provincial Park, known for its quartzite ridges and sapphire lakes.

Visit Key Landmarks: Drive to attractions like Science North, a unique science centre, or the Big Nickel, a famous landmark. Public transport to some locations can be time-consuming or limited.

Enjoy Flexibility: Public transport may not align with your schedule. With a rental car, you can visit destinations whenever you want, making spontaneous trips easier.

1. Age RequirementsMost rental companies require drivers to be at least 21 years old. Drivers under 25 may face additional surcharges.

2. Driver’s License & DocumentationA valid driver’s license is required. International visitors may need an International Driving Permit (IDP) if their license is not in English or French.

3. Insurance & DepositsBasic insurance is usually included, but additional coverage like collision damage waiver (CDW) is available. A security deposit is held on a credit card.

4. Mileage & Fuel PolicyMileage policies vary. Some rentals offer unlimited mileage, while others have restrictions. Fuel policies often require returning the car with a full tank.

5. Additional FeesExtra charges can apply for additional drivers, one-way rentals, or optional add-ons like GPS or child seats.

Seasonal Trends

Peak season (June to August): Expect prices to increase by 20-30% due to higher demand from tourists and holidaymakers.

Low season (November to February): Rental rates often come with discounts as demand decreases during the colder months.

Top Attractions to Discover

  • Science North

    An interactive science museum featuring exhibits on geology, biology, and technology.

  • The Big Nickel

    A large replica of a Canadian nickel, symbolising Sudbury's mining heritage.

  • Killarney Provincial Park

    Known for its stunning quartzite ridges and pristine lakes, ideal for hiking and canoeing.

Useful Tips for Visiting Sudbury

  • Plan for Weather

    Sudbury experiences varied weather. Check the forecast and prepare accordingly, especially during winter.

  • Watch for Wildlife

    Be aware of wildlife crossings, especially in rural areas.

  • Allow Extra Time

    Factor in extra travel time, particularly during rush hours and winter conditions.

  • Use Navigation Apps

    Utilise apps like Google Maps for real-time traffic updates and navigation.

Key Transportation Hubs in Sudbury

Major Bus Stations

Sudbury Transit Terminal

Located downtown, serving local bus routes.

Railway Stations

Sudbury Railway Station

Serves regional routes, connecting to other cities.

Airports

Greater Sudbury Airport (YSB)

Offers flights to major Canadian cities.
